  • Unit is designed to Original Equipment (OE) fit, form and function requirements accomplished by leveraging Spectra Premium’s OE engine management systems design expertise
  • Platinum connector threads reduce the number of connection points for faster reaction to change
  • Ceramic-built printed circuit boards are protected by silica gel, providing superior resistance to temperature changes and vehicle vibrations
  • Ceramic board provides reliable voltage to eliminate engine rough-idle problems
  • Each new sensor is road tested to ensure real world performance and to verify that each design meets Spectra Premium’s high standards for quality

    All good so far. Was willing to take a risk and buy a cheaper sensor for my 03′ Sentra Spec V. Dropped right in after cleaning the original housing and used the included tool to tighten the screws. Car started right up and I was finally able to rev beyond 2000rpm again. Did a throttle position and air flow relearn and went for a drive, car runs just as well as before and pulls great off a roll.

    Will try to update in a few months to a year if I don’t have any problems. As of now, I’ve given this 5-stars just because it dropped right in and did what it’s designed to do.
